• Finely chop garlic. • In a small bowl, combine the honey, soy sauce, water and half the garlic. Set aside. Little cooks: Take charge by combining the sauces!
• In a large bowl, combine beef mince, fine breadcrumbs, ginger paste, the egg, chicken-style stock powder and remaining garlic. • Using damp hands, roll heaped spoonfuls of beef mixture into small meatballs (4-5 per person). Transfer to a plate. • Set your air fryer to 200°C. Place meatballs into air fryer basket and cook until cooked through, 8-10 minutes. Add the honey-soy mixture and stir until the meatballs are coated in the sauce. TIP: No air fryer? Heat a frying pan over medium-high heat with a drizzle of olive oil. Cook meatballs, until browned and cooked through, 8-10 minutes. In the last minute, add the honey-soy mixture, tossing, until coated.
• Meanwhile, thinly slice pear and celery. Thinly slice fresh chilli (if using). • In a medium bowl, combine plant-based mayo, ponzu sauce, pear, celery, slaw mix, baby leaves and crushed peanuts. Season with salt and pepper. Toss to coat.
• Thinly slice spring onion. • Divide pear slaw between bowls. Top with honey, soy and ginger beef meatballs. • Spoon over any remaining glaze from the pan. • Garnish with chilli and spring onion to serve. Enjoy!
